Construction Of A Line Chart Model For Postoperative Patients With Osteosarcoma

Purpose:Osteosarcoma is the most common primary malignant tumor of the bone,which mainly occurs in children and adolescents.The extremities are the most common sites of bone tumors,often in the distal femur and proximal tibia,mainly through blood metastasis.The main method for the treatment of osteosarcoma is surgical treatment,but single surgical treatment can not improve the survival time of patients,and the survival rate of patients with metastatic or recurrent osteosarcoma is still very low.The multidisciplinary model of surgery combined with radiotherapy and chemotherapy can effectively improve the prognosis of some patients,and in order to intervene patients with different risk levels and improve their prognosis,it is particularly important to better understand the prognostic factors of osteosarcoma of the extremities.The purpose of this study is to retrospectively analyze the clinical characteristics of postoperative osteosarcoma patients,and an accurate line chart is developed by selecting effective factors by single factor and multiple factors,and the survival time of postoperative osteosarcoma patients is predicted.This tool can provide effective information for doctors and patients.Methods:The relevant clinical variables of 805 postoperative patients with osteosarcoma diagnosed pathologically from 2004 to 2014 are collected through the Surveillance,Epidemiology and End Results(SEER)Database of National Cancer Institute.Major factors are age,sex,race,tumor location,marital status,tissue type,tumor grade,T stage,N stage,tumor size,mode of operation,chemotherapy,radiotherapy,lymph node resection,bone metastasis,lung metastasis and important follow-up materials(survival outcome and total survival time).The factors related to survival are obtained by univariate and multivariate COX analysis.To accurately predict the3-year and 5-year survival rate of postoperative patients with osteosarcoma.At the same time,the model is verified by internal data,and the accuracy of the model is further evaluated by C index and calibration chart.Results:In the survival analysis of the main treatment methods,whether chemotherapy or not has no significant effect on overall survival and tumor-specific survival(P>0.05);surgical methods,radiotherapy or not,and lymph node surgery have significant statistics on survival Significance(all P <0.05);single factor and multivariate analysis screened out age,tumor grade,T stage,N stage,tumor size,tissue type,lung metastasis,tumor primary site and radiotherapy are independent factors that affect overall survival Risk factors.Based on these significantly related factors,a nomogram model of 3-year and 5-year survival rates is established.The C index of the modeling group and the verification group are both greater than 0.7.In addition,the calibration charts also show the survival of the modeling group and the verification group.The consistency of the rates is good.Conclusions:In this study,we established an accurate model of patients and survival rate after osteosarcoma surgery based on osteosarcoma patients in the SEER database,which is of great significance for clinicians to formulate further treatment plans.
